Output e87a8de7c41341652c0d35500f82f33c717d16a7da86ae63e0cd10f3fb3ae74e:0

value
665847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ad5a630c1e007f057086088fd3b330496451dda4 OP_EQUAL
address
3HVd6vTpEJxyYanqsDmMNoZPpw7eqtsLW8
transaction
e87a8de7c41341652c0d35500f82f33c717d16a7da86ae63e0cd10f3fb3ae74e
spent
true